码迷,mamicode.com
首页 > 编程语言 > 详细

springMVC是如何实现参数封装和自动返回Json的

时间:2019-11-14 21:55:15      阅读:111      评论:0      收藏:0      [点我收藏+]

标签:封装   返回   string   pos   convert   格式   span   springmvc   message   

HTTP 请求和响应是基于文本的,意味着浏览器和服务器通过交换原始文本进行通信。但是,使用 Spring,controller 类中的方法返回纯 ‘String’ 类型和域模型(或其他 Java 内建对象)。如何将对象序列化/反序列化为原始文本?这由HttpMessageConverter 处理。

 

在进行post请求时,封装在requestBody里的参数被HttpMessageConverter序列化,封装到vo对象里。

 

在进行数据返回时,HttpMessageConverter将我们的对象序列化成Json格式,封装到reponseBody里。

 

注:以上为本菜鸡的理解,如果不对,请勿喷!

springMVC是如何实现参数封装和自动返回Json的

标签:封装   返回   string   pos   convert   格式   span   springmvc   message   

原文地址:https://www.cnblogs.com/uzxin/p/11861954.html

(0)
(0)
   
举报
评论 一句话评论(0
登录后才能评论!
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!